Funckenhausen

330 hectares of virgin land were purchased in 2003 by Kurt Heinlein, in the San Rafael zone of south Mendoza. The vineyards were planted next to the Diamante River on the foothills of the Andes Mountains at 2726 feet above sea level, on sandy chalk soils. Franco Lucchini is the viticulturist and Jimena Lopez is the winemaker. Mr Heinlein is of German descent and Funckenhausen celebrates his heritage. Ms Lopez is one of a growing group of young and very talented female winemakers in South America.

Malbec Blend

A special selection of 50% Malbec, 35% Bonarda, 15% Syrah destemmed and fermented in concrete tanks with selected yeast. Followed by a spontaneous malolactic fermentation. The resulting wine is blended with 20% reserva malbec from the previous vintage aged in used American and French oak. Bottled in a Liter bottle after a slight filtration. Winemaker Jimena Lopez.

Cabernet Sauvignon

85% Cabernet sauvignon, 12% Malbec, 3% Petit Verdot

Hand harvested, fermented in small concrete tanks with selected yeast, malolactic is spontaneous. The wine is aged in both American and french oak barrels and clarified before bottling. Jimena Lopez leads the winemaking team. Lopez is  part of a  talented group of new, young, female winemakers in South America.
